Ordinals
beta
Address 3Q7rxikZxiMxeksrawteUXaxAsbKcBrUk4
sat balance
20752008
runes balances
outputs
2cef9eb8993b34ead27038e8c3e97b92e5b8171a3eab4759930bb2f01728d5d0:0